About Us

Teys Australia is a beef processing and food production business, established in 1946. Today, we are best known for providing quality Aussie beef to customers here in Australia and around the world.

With operations across 14 locations in Qld, NSW, Victoria, and South Australia, we are the second largest beef processor and exporter in Australia, employing over 5000 passionate people who drive our success, and bring their very best to work every day.

Together, we focus on feeding people and enriching lives. Join us!

About the Role

Teys Australia is seeking an experienced Shipping Manager to join our Logistics team in Eight Mile Plains, south side of Brisbane. This exciting role is responsible for managing Teys export cargo movements ensuring delivery in full and on time.

Reporting to the Group Export Logistics Manager, the successful candidate will manage a broad portfolio of activities including stock control, schedule and booking of transport services as well as collaborating with strategies to reduce costs and mitigate risks.

Additionally, the position is responsible for generating reports on export results, inventory management, and accurate accruals for freight and cartages, while overseeing supplier invoicing and supporting the logistics team with other activities.
